Strong's G938 · Greek

βασίλισσα

basilissa · bas-il'-is-sah

feminine from 936; a queen


Scholarly Lexicons

Abbott-Smith Manual Greek Lexicon

βασίλισσα (G938)

4 βασίλισσα , -ης, ἡ (in Attic, βασιλεία , βασιλίς ), [in LXX chiefly for מַלְכָּה ;] a queen : Mt 12:42 , Lk 11:31 , Ac 8:27 , Re 18:7 .†
